Local Governors visit and meet the School Council

By Fiona Wilkins - February 26th, 2026 | Posted in Article

We were delighted to welcome members of our Local Governing Body into to school to meet with members of staff, students and have a look around the school.

An absolute highlight of their visit was meeting with members of the School Council. They told governors about recent initiatives which included a safeguarding walk where the students pointed out a few areas of fencing that were in need of some attention.

Local Governors form part of our Local Governing Body (LGB), a committee of the OHCAT Board. Our governors work collectively to:

  • Support strategic leadership by upholding the Trust’s vision and values.
  • Monitor educational standards, including pupil progress, safeguarding, and curriculum opportunities and quality.
  • Oversee operational and financial compliance, ensuring resources are used effectively and policies are followed.
  • Champion staff wellbeing and development, contributing to recruitment and supporting leadership.
  • Engage with the school community, acting as a bridge between the academy, parents, and wider stakeholders.

Our governors come from diverse backgrounds and bring a range of skills. What unites them is a shared commitment to improving outcomes and transforming lives for all pupils.
